Superstatistics, thermodynamics, and fluctuations

Sumiyoshi Abe, Christian Beck, E. G. D. Cohen

Published 2007-05-01, updated 2007-07-20Version 2

A thermodynamic-like formalism is developed for superstatistical systems based on conditional entropies. This theory takes into account large-scale variations of intensive variables of systems in nonequilibrium stationary states. Ordinary thermodynamics is recovered as a special case of the present theory, and corrections to it can be systematically evaluated. A generalization of Einstein's relation for fluctuations is presented using a maximum entropy condition.
